$a,b$ and $c$ are all natural numbers, and function $f(x)$ always returns a natural number. If$$ \sum_{n=b}^{a} f(n) = c,$$ in terms of $b,c$ and $f$, how would you solve for $a$? Do I require more information to solve for $a$?
EDIT: If $x$ increases $f(x)$ increases
